Description

These Measurement Word Problems Worksheets and Activities will help you teach those tricky word problems involving measurement and length. This resource perfectly follows the measurement word problems standards for 2nd grade.

Everything you need to teach length word problems is here in this resource from direct instruction, to guided practice, to independent practice, to assessment, to center activities.

This word problems with measurement resource gives students scaffolded practice - helping them master solving measurement word problems quickly and effectively.

Included are 3 lessons covering measurement word problems. Here are the topics of those lessons:

  1. Add & Subtract with Measurements
  2. Find Unknown Measurements
  3. Use a Number Line to Solve Measurement Word Problems

Here’s what’s included in each of these lessons:

  • Display Pages: These are the landscape pages. Use these to introduce the “I can” statement and to teach the skills. These are perfect for direct instruction and provide a very visual learning experience for students. Simply model solving the measurement word problems or have students help you.

  • Measurement Word Problems Worksheets: Print these off for students. Do a couple problems together and have students do the rest by themselves. Great for low-prep guided practice and independent practice!

  • Scoot Activity & Task Cards: Print these on cardstock and cut the task cards apart. Tape the problems up around your classroom. Print the recording sheet for students. Students go around and solve the measurement word problems. They write their answers on the recording page. These get students up out of their seats and moving - making your lessons more engaging!

  • Puzzle Activity: Print these off and cut apart. Students line up the measurement word problems to their matching equations and part-part-whole diagrams. I like to have students work with a partner. This gives them support as they do these fun, hands-on measurement word problem activities!

  • Exit Tickets: Use these to quickly assess how students can solve word problems with measurement. There are 3 different versions so that students can have a different ticket than the student sitting next to them. There is even a section where students self-reflect on how they understood the lesson. Use these during an observation and get high marks!

  • Answer Keys: Use the answer keys so that students can check their own work – saving you valuable prep time! Plus, students get immediate feedback.

Use addition and subtraction within 100 to solve word problems involving lengths that are given in the same units, e.g., by using drawings (such as drawings of rulers) and equations with a symbol for the unknown number to represent the problem.
Represent whole numbers as lengths from 0 on a number line diagram with equally spaced points corresponding to the numbers 0, 1, 2,..., and represent whole-number sums and differences within 100 on a number line diagram.
